Re: My 2002 Santa Fe is locked and the remote will not...
First of all, has the burglar alarm been activated? If so, you can enter the vehicle with the key, put the key in the ignition and turn it to 'RUN' or 'ON" and then wait 3 to 5 minutes for the burglar alarm to stop. You should then be able to start the engine. You still need to have a qualified/certified Hyundai Service Technician properly diagnose the problem with the remote (Keyless Entry & Alarm System).

their is a way to do it but recheck battery first sometimes the relearn process doesnt work or the fob itself is dead also if auto /remote start will need dealer to flash fob ---- 2002 santa fe and followed programming instructions and eventually was able to program the new remote. But, I did not realize I had to program my existing remote at the same time. Since, I have retried programming both remotes many times with no success--the new one works, but the old one won't. The instructions were: 1) Locate switch under dash, behind fuse box; 2) Turn ignition switch on, but don't start engine; 3) Wait 5 seconds, set memory switch to SET position; 4) Press remote LOCK button; press second remote transmitter LOCK button; 5) Set memory switch to OFF; 6) Switch ignition OFF. 7) Confirm programming by locking and unlocking vehicle. System operation Pressing remote control lock button locks vehicle and activates system Fig. 1 . Indicators flash once. Pressing remote control unlock button unlocks vehicle and deactivates system Fig. 1 . Indicators flash twice. Fig. 1 Synchronization When System malfunction. Remote control added or replaced. How Access alarm system control module located under driver's side lower fascia Fig. 2 . Set memory switch to SET position. Press remote control lock or unlock button. Set memory switch to OFF position. Confirm synchronization has been successful by locking and unlocking vehicle. Repeat procedure for second remote control. Synchronization can also be carried out using diagnostic equipment. NOTE: A maximum of 2 remote controls can be programmed. NOTE: If remote control fails, system can be deactivated as detailed in the owner's handbook.

i had a problem not unlike this in my santa fe 1.9td uk spec. my car had been sitting for a few months and when i returned to drive it again the same problem came to light. i also rep[lsaced the key fob. it could be one of two things. firstly the systen might neen re-set. if you disconnect the battery for 2 hours then attach ti again it might work. if this fails it might be the actuator in one of the doors. if it is faulty then it only semi closes the lock, but it then thinks that has to lock again. and locks the door. hope this helps. oscargilpin
